Я создал пакет python и загрузил его в PyPI. В моем пакете используется код, который отображает файл выходных данных. Файл данных сохраняется в той же относительной директории, где находится код:
output_data_file = open(Path.cwd() / "filename.txt", mode='w')
Этот код позволяет правильно создать допустимый файл в любой ОС. Однако расположение вывода не интуитивно понятно. В Ubuntu это дает мне очень длинный путь, например: ~ / lib / python3 .8 / site-packages / NameOfMyPackage /...
Есть ли вместо этого более интуитивный способ создания более короткого пути к каталогу которые могут быть распознаны любыми операционными системами. Например, системный путь root или Documents / Deskop?